A new tap and grill is just weeks away from opening their doors in Belle River.
The Bourbon Tap & Grill is expected to open by the end of February, at the location of the former Mr. Biggs Sports Bar and Eatery.
George Marar and Joe Sperduti already co-own two locations - one at 1199 Ottawa St. in Windsor and another at 12049 Tecumseh Rd. E. in Tecumseh.
The bar and restaurant is expected to employ approximately 30 people between the kitchen and front staff, and will be hosting a job fair in early February for those interested.
This location will offer live music, a full kitchen, billiard tables, TV's, and a wood burning oven to sell their signature pizzas.
This Bourbon will also feature garage doors that can be opened in the summer time, as well as a wrap around patio.
George Marar, co-owner of The Bourbon, says this location will offer all of the same amenities as the other two location.
